    Crafting Heartfelt Sympathy Messages

    In times of grief, words often fail us. It can be challenging to find the right words to express sympathy and support to someone who is mourning. Crafting a sincere and heartfelt sympathy message is a delicate task but worth the effort, as it can provide comfort and reassurance to those in need.

    When writing a sympathy message, keep in mind that your goal is to offer solace and support, not to solve the problem or alleviate the grief completely. Here are several tips and examples to help you compose a comforting message.

    1. Begin with a Salutation

    Starting your sympathy message with a warm and respectful salutation sets the tone. A few examples include:

    • Dear [Name],
    • My Dearest [Name],
    • Hello [Name],
    • To the Family of [Name],

    2. Express Your Condolences

    Convey your sorrow for their loss. Phrasing this expression with sincerity is key. Examples include:

    • I am so sorry to hear about your loss.
    • My heart goes out to you during this difficult time.
    • Words cannot express how deeply sorry I am for your loss.
    • Sending you love and prayers during this incredibly challenging time.

    3. Share a Fond Memory

    If you knew the deceased, sharing a personal memory can be touching and healing. This can help the bereaved feel less alone in their grief and more connected to the person who has passed.

    • [Name] was always so kind to everyone around them. I remember when...
    • One of my favorite memories of [Name] was when...
    • I'll never forget the joy [Name] brought to our lives through...
    • [Name] had a unique way of bringing laughter to every situation. Like that one time when...

    4. Offer Support or Assistance

    Sometimes the most comforting thing you can offer is your assistance. Make sure to be specific about how you are willing to help.

    • Please know that I am here for you. If you need anyone to run errands, listen, or just be present, I’m just a call away.
    • I’m bringing over a meal this Sunday. Let’s find some time to sit together, or I can drop it off quietly.
    • Let me know if you need any help with arrangements or errands. I’m here for you.

    5. Sign Off with Warmth

    Close your message with warmth. This reassures them of your continued presence and support.

    • With all my sympathy,
    • Peace and comfort to you,
    • Sincerely, and with love,
    • In friendship and support,

    Crafting Your Own Sympathy Messages

    While conventional phrases are helpful, it's important to make your message personal. Tailor your words based on your relationship with the grieving person and your experiences with the deceased.
